Community association elects officers at March 3 AGM

The Watch Lake-Green Lake Community Association held its annual general meeting on March 3 with 15 members attending

The Watch Lake-Green Lake Community Association (WLGLCA) held its annual general meeting on March 3 with 15 members attending.

The executive includes president Joni Guenther, vice-president Guy Poliseno, treasurer Tanya Richards and directors Carol Roberts, Janet Boyd, Alan Boyd and Gisele Poliseno.

The association's events for this year include the gymkhanas on July 11 and Aug. 8 and the Christmas Party in December. The association will also have a concession at the Fishing Derby on June 6-7.

The WLGLCA meetings will now be on the second Wednesday of every month commencing April 8. There is a social at 7 p.m. and the meeting starts at 7:30. New members are always welcome.

Bursary available

The 70 Mile and Area Community Fund Committee held a meeting Feb. 24 to announce applications for a bursary are now being accepted.

The bursary is offered to assist graduates who are continuing their education.

To apply, send a letter of 300 to 500 words and include your goals, education plans, and your connection to the area. Include any volunteer work, extra-curricular activities, and community service. Send your application to The 70 Mile and Area Fund: c/o S. Wheeler; Box 29; 70 Mile House, B.C. V0K 2K0 before April 30.
